Made from fermented real pear juice, Somersby Pear Cider is a refreshing and crisp cider free from artificial sweeteners and flavouring. With 4.5% in alcohol content, its natural sweet bubbly flavour is best served with ice to ensure every sip gives you an unexpected punch with an exciting, thirst quenching experience.

The Maybank GO Ahead Challenge 2014 is back this year for its 3rd instalment and promises a whole lot of new challenges. If you don't already know, the challenge is designed to stretch participant's potential, pushing them to the limit and yet completely aligned to Maybank's mission in humanise financial services.


The Maybank GO Ahead Challenged is deemed an Amazing Race or The Apprentice program. The challenge aims at using a younger method in attracting and reaching out to young graduate's the unconventional way. This has proven to be an successful platform to cultivate and demonstrate potential talents that Maybank is consistently on the look out for. After all discovering talents at a young age is the essence for a better tomorrow.
